Output d6fbc4ade7e33f0f339fd762dd67229f0c7bd04411ad20224fc1efc1dc07a526:2

value
43139
script pubkey
OP_0 OP_PUSHBYTES_20 a80ca99dcfdff25a8dbbafc7e7687f3a73a2fc16
address
bc1q4qx2n8w0mle94rdm4lr7w6rl8fe69lqknu92jz
transaction
d6fbc4ade7e33f0f339fd762dd67229f0c7bd04411ad20224fc1efc1dc07a526
confirmations
29208
spent
true